من المفترض أن يعود اختبار الخوف من عدمه ("abcdefghjklmnopqrstuvwxyz") بدون تعريف لأنه من المفترض ألا تكون هناك أحرف مفقودة في السلسلة. ومع ذلك ، من الواضح جدًا أن الحرف "i" مفقود. الحل الخاص بي صحيح ويجتاز جميع الاختبارات ويعود غير محدد عندما تحتوي السلسلة أعلاه على i مفقود.
آمل أن يساعدك هذا يا رفاق في اكتشاف هذا الخطأ
fixtheelvis شكرًا على الإبلاغ عن هذا - يا له من صيد! :فتح الفم:
لا تمانع في الروبوت ، فنحن لم نعلمه الأخلاق الصحيحة بعد! :ابتسامة:
هذا هو التأكيد الخاص بحالة الاختبار التي تقوم بالرجوع إليها:
assert.isUndefined(fearNotLetter('abcdefghijklmnopqrstuvwxyz'), 'message: <code>fearNotLetter(\"abcdefghjklmnopqrstuvwxyz\")</code> should return undefined.');
كما ترى ، تتطابق كل حالة اختبار مع تأكيد مع شيء يتم تقييمه إلى صح / خطأ ورسالة. في هذه الحالة ، من المفترض أن تعرض الرسالة التسلسل الكامل - ولكن عندما تشير للخارج ، فإنها تفتقد الحرف i. نظرًا لأنها جزء من سلسلة الرسائل ، فهي مرئية للمخيمين (على الأقل أولئك الذين يلتقطونها!) ، لكنها لن تؤثر على التأكيد. لهذا السبب لا يزال الاختبار يمر.
منذ اكتشافك هذا الخطأ ، هل ترغب في تقديم مساهمة وإصلاحه؟ سأكون سعيدًا أنا والمساهمون الآخرون بإرشادك خلال هذه العملية! :ابتسامة:
مرحبا،raisedadeadGreenheart يمكنني إصلاح هذه المشكلة؟
@ كوين - ح شكرا ، سيكون ذلك رائعا!
راجع CONTRIBUTING.md للحصول على المساعدة للبدء وتعال وتحدث معنا في غرفة دردشة المساهمين إذا كان لديك أي أسئلة.
ترميز سعيد! :ابتسامة:
التعليق الأكثر فائدة
مرحبا،raisedadeadGreenheart يمكنني إصلاح هذه المشكلة؟